diff --git a/application/api/controller/Article.php b/application/api/controller/Article.php index 5ca54a4..318ea85 100644 --- a/application/api/controller/Article.php +++ b/application/api/controller/Article.php @@ -1304,11 +1304,12 @@ class Article extends Controller { } } + /** * @title 获取待审文章 * @description 获取待审文章 * @author wangjinlei - * @url /api/User/applyReviewerForReviewer + * @url /api/Article/getReviewerArticles * @method POST * * @@ -1323,6 +1324,29 @@ class Article extends Controller { return jsonSuccess($re); } + /** + * @title 获取待审文章 + * @description 获取待审文章 + * @author wangjinlei + * @url /api/Article/getReviewerArticlesForJournal + * @method POST + * + * @param name:issn type:string require:1 desc:issn + * + * @return articles:待审稿件# + */ + public function getReviewerArticlesForJournal(){ + $data = $this->request->post(); + + $journal_info = $this->journal_obj->where('issn',$data['issn'])->find(); + $list = $this->article_obj + ->field('t_article.*,t_journal.title journalname') + ->join('t_journal', 't_journal.journal_id = t_article.journal_id', 'LEFT') + ->where('t_article.state',2)->where('t_article.journal_id',$journal_info['journal_id'])->limit(3)->select(); + $re['articles'] = $list; + return jsonSuccess($re); + } + // public function cfreviewer(){